The bottom line
Dragon was the gold standard for desktop dictation for decades. However, it''s Windows-only, uses older correction technology, and Nuance has shifted focus to healthcare under Microsoft. Kensi brings modern AI correction, cross-platform support (Mac + iOS), screen context awareness, and a privacy-first architecture at a fraction of the cost.

Dragon NaturallySpeaking strengths
- Industry-proven speech recognition with decades of development
- Strong vocabulary learning and user adaptation
- Enterprise features and compliance certifications
- Voice commands for document editing

No. Dragon for Mac was discontinued in 2018. Kensi is built specifically for macOS and iOS.
Nuance (acquired by Microsoft) has shifted Dragon''s development focus to healthcare (Dragon Medical). The consumer/professional versions receive minimal updates. Kensi is actively developed with regular updates.
